Transaction 57ef26a5ac6e2d1b4807bbb4973c787ae06997cacebece37012006b017c3bdd6
1 Input
1 Output
-
57ef26a5ac6e2d1b4807bbb4973c787ae06997cacebece37012006b017c3bdd6:0
- value
- 13102395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7704d5b21f56b0f152b14b24a27bd346d45508d OP_EQUAL
- address
- 3JQx7YJCgU9gpSEtvLobf2vFNiXu3uCYoH